YSL L'Homme EDP Review

YSL L'Homme EDP, or Eau de Parfum, is the more intense and long-lasting version of the classic YSL L'Homme fragrance. Released in 2006, this scent was created by perfumers Anne Flipo, Dominique Ropion, and Pierre Wargnye. The EDP opens with a burst of fresh and spicy top notes, including ginger, bergamot, and lemon. The heart of the fragrance reveals floral notes of violet and basil, adding a sophisticated touch to the blend. The base notes of tonka bean and vetiver provide a warm and sensual finish to the fragrance.

One of the standout features of YSL L'Homme EDP is its longevity. The higher concentration of fragrance oils in the EDP formulation allows the scent to linger on the skin for hours, making it an excellent choice for those who prefer a long-lasting fragrance. The richness and depth of the EDP also make it a great option for evening wear or special occasions when you want to make a statement.

YSL EDT vs EDP

Now, let's compare YSL L'Homme EDP with its counterpart, YSL L'Homme EDT. The Eau de Toilette (EDT) version of the fragrance is the original and more classic option. Launched in 2006, the same year as the EDP, YSL L'Homme EDT was created by perfumers Anne Flipo, Pierre Wargnye, and Dominique Ropion. The EDT opens with a fresh and spicy blend of notes, including ginger, bergamot, and lemon, similar to the EDP. However, the EDT leans more towards a lighter and fresher composition, making it a great everyday fragrance for those who prefer a more subtle scent.

One of the key differences between the EDT and EDP versions of YSL L'Homme is their longevity and projection. The EDT is generally lighter and more airy compared to the richer and more intense EDP. While the EDT may not last as long on the skin as the EDP, it is still a well-loved fragrance for its versatility and easy-to-wear nature.

La Nuit EDT vs EDP

Moving on to the evening counterpart of YSL L'Homme, La Nuit de L’Homme EDT and La Nuit de L’Homme EDP offer two distinct interpretations of a seductive and mysterious scent. Launched in 2009, La Nuit de L’Homme EDT was created by perfumers Anne Flipo, Pierre Wargnye, and Dominique Ropion. The fragrance opens with cardamom and bergamot, leading to a heart of cedar and lavender, and a base of vetiver and caraway. This blend of notes creates a sensual and masculine scent that is perfect for a night out.
